Output e958d2a1ac5bd60151f28dacde876c84dcf17af58ea4e9b67153a65e6eca8820:0

value
2100462
script pubkey
OP_0 OP_PUSHBYTES_20 92cf3b5c28997d58f8e7bcb5439e3a5511dfb2f7
address
ltc1qjt8nkhpgn9743788hj65883625galvhhxdulfy
transaction
e958d2a1ac5bd60151f28dacde876c84dcf17af58ea4e9b67153a65e6eca8820
spent
true